POLICE are appealing for information after a gang of thieves targeted homes in the Braintree and Uttlesford districts.
Officers were called to London Road, Great Notley around 9.10pm on Sunday following reports four men had broken into a property.
The men are understood to have stolen jewellery from inside before leaving the area in a white Audi Q2 around 9.20pm.
Police were then called to an address in West Road, Stansted, 30 minutes later after receiving reports four men had got out of a white Audi Q2 and broken into a home.
It was also reported that one of the occupants was threatened with a knife, whilst other occupants were assaulted and verbally threatened.
A number of jewellery items were taken.
One victim was treated for minor injuries.
Essex Police says it is treating the two incidents as linked and is now appealing to the public for information.
A spokesman added: "Our detectives would like to speak to anyone who has information about either incident or if you were in the areas around the time and witnessed any suspicious behaviour or have dash cam footage.
"We're also keen to hear from anyone who live on either of the roads or neighbouring streets and have ring doorbell footage."
